If you have lost your Hyundai car key, there are several options to get a replacement. You can go to the dealer, contact a locksmith, or place an order for an online key.

Cost of the Key
Hyundai provides a variety keys for cars. Each key is priced differently. Older cars, for instance have a simple valet key that can be replaced at the locksmith's shop for $50 each. Key fobs are used in modern vehicles that have chip that allows them to open doors and begin the vehicle. These fobs are available on the internet or at the dealership. However, they cost more to replace than traditional car keys.
A key fob needs to be programmed too, which can cost as much as $300. Consider purchasing a blank key and letting an auto locksmith or locksmith program cut it for you. This will reduce the cost of your key. This is less expensive than buying a new key from a dealer and it could be easier to obtain the replacement key if you've replaced your ignition cylinder prior to.
You may also get your Hyundai brought to the dealership to obtain a new key. This is time-consuming and costly. In addition, the dealership will require proof of ownership such as your vehicle title or registration documents, driver's license and insurance card. If you do not have any of these documents, it could be very difficult to obtain an alternative key from the dealer. If you choose this option, make sure to bring a spare key to the dealership so they can pair it with the ignition of your car.

Cost of Programming the Key
Hyundai smart keys come with additional costs. Smart keys are equipped with a transponder that is more secure than regular keys. To work properly they require a specific programming procedure. If you wish to have a smart key programed, you will need to visit the dealership or an auto locksmith.
A dead battery could be a cause of your hyundai remote replacement remote key fob not working. If you have the knowledge, you can replace the battery by yourself. Key fobs typically have an indentation on the side that is open by using an screwdriver. Once you have removed the old battery, you can install an entirely new one and connect it to your vehicle.

Cost of Locksmith Service
If you've lost your key or simply want to duplicate it, the cost can be substantial. You can purchase an exchange from the dealer, have your car tow-towed to dealership, or hire an automotive locksmith. Each has its own pros and cons, however the most important thing to consider is the kind of key you require. For instance, a newer Hyundai vehicle will require a chipkey with an intelligent fob, push to start and remote capability. These keys are more expensive than traditional key replicas however, they are more secure.
The cost of replacing the key will vary based on the year and model of your Hyundai vehicle. The cost will also differ depending on whether you wish to have the key programmed electronically. Typically, an auto locksmith will need the VIN number of the vehicle, as well as the immobilizer code to program the new key.
In addition to the cost of the replacement key, you'll have to pay for locksmith services and any associated shipping costs. This can be a significant cost, but it's worth it to ensure your security and the integrity of your vehicle. You can save money by having a spare Hyundai key in your vehicle on all occasions or by purchasing a new Hyundai Key online and having it cut and programmed by an automotive locksmith.
